just extract all the files from a skin and see what needs to be put where [but dont ever steal so much as a pixel]
- like has been mentioned 'skinner atlas' is good for that, but any skin will do - it takes a bit of working out but when i was unsure of something i would just bung in some fluro colours and then see what happened.
